Abstract in different language: We propose an affordable antenna measurement system designed for educational purposes. The system is scalable and easy to implement in both hardware and software. The integrated single-board computer (SBC) and the radio frequency printed circuit boards (RF PCBs) provide full independence from bulk microwave measurement devices and personal computers. The pattern measurement done with the system has been compared with the numerically obtained radiation pattern from ANSYS HFSS software. ±1dB detection capability is verified for a single lobe antenna.
